Major League Baseball is not allowing its players to participate in the Venezuelan Professional Baseball League this winter.
The decision follows President Donald Trump's move this month to freeze all assets from the government of President Nicolás Maduro, as well as prohibit transactions with Venezuela.
The MLB rule won't prevent Venezuelan players from returning to their home country in the off-season.
